A toluene-based synthetic resin mounting medium. The right choice for both rapid mounting and long term storage of slides. Its low viscosity allows for a thinner mounting layer offering better optical quality and bubble-free preparations. It has a refractive index near that of a fixed protein which helps to keep images free of distortion. Ideal for mounting coverslips to slides with thick or thin specimens Permount preserves most biological stains with little or no fading when the slides are stored in darkness. It contains an anti-oxidant to prevent the formation of annular rings and its high softening point (155°C/311°F) makes it suitable for microprojection. Storage :RT Technical Data Sheet MSDS_17986

Poly-L-Lysine Hydrobromide 30,000-70,000

CAS #25988-63-0A polycation, which binds to DNA, red cell membranes and any negatively, charged proteins. It is useful for promoting cell adhesion; for the preparation of polycationic beads, useful in immobilization techniques; immobilization of membranes; immobilization of plant protoplasts. In cell culture, immobilization by micro encapsulation with the alginate-poly-L-lysine microcapsule system. We offer a prepared 0.1% aqueous solution, micro-filtered, which is ideal for cell culture growth.MSDSTechnical Data Sheet : Poly L Lysine Solution
